The spring rods are pressed up against the valance sides.  When I was taking out the mini blinds up in the front I actually removed the valance (help on by 2 crews on each side and them removed the blind and hanger.  In the back over the bed I started to look at the blinds and figured out that i could unclip the blinds and pull them out without removing the valance.  I kept the blind hanger up there.  I think if i was doing it again I would be removing the valance and doing it the correct way.

OK the blinds that came with the camper just were not our style.  After going out a few times we decided to pull them out and make curtains.  Thankful my wife can sew so that was not a problem.  We installed spring rods up in the valances to hold the curtains.  Below are before and after Pictures:
